The Importance of a Solid Foundation
A well-engineered main chassis is far more than just a frame; it's the key to consistent handling, superior ride quality, and lasting durability. A poorly designed or constructed chassis can lead to a host of problems, from premature wear and tear on other components to a generally unstable and uncomfortable ride. This is especially crucial for luxury vehicles.

Key Benefits of a Robust Chassis
- Enhanced Handling: A rigid chassis minimizes flex and twist, resulting in more responsive steering and improved control, providing a superior driving experience.
- Superior Ride Comfort: By absorbing road imperfections and distributing forces evenly, a strong chassis contributes to a smoother, more comfortable ride.
- Increased Durability: A robust chassis protects the vehicle's core structure from damage and reduces the risk of costly repairs down the line, preserving the vehicle's investment value.
- Optimized Performance: A solid foundation allows the vehicle's powertrain and suspension systems to perform at their peak efficiency, maximizing acceleration, braking, and overall performance.
